Page MenuHomePhorge
Feed Search

May 18 2023

atul committed rCOMMa3c30f5c3866: [native] `codeVersion` -> 217.
May 18 2023, 3:33 PM

May 16 2023

atul accepted D7846: [native] Add loading spinner to RegistrationButton loading variant.
May 16 2023, 10:13 PM
atul accepted D7845: [native] Introduce RegistrationContainer to handle SafeAreaView.

Looks good

May 16 2023, 10:13 PM
atul accepted D7844: [native] Add SIWEPanel to ConnectEthereum screen.
May 16 2023, 10:12 PM
atul accepted D7843: [native] Split onClosing and onClosed params to SIWEPanel.
May 16 2023, 10:11 PM
atul closed D7847: [web] Call `create_thread` from `CommunityCreationModal` on form submission.
May 16 2023, 10:09 PM
atul committed rCOMM3fdb12d33cde: [web] Call `create_thread` from `CommunityCreationModal` on form submission.
May 16 2023, 10:09 PM
atul updated the diff for D7847: [web] Call `create_thread` from `CommunityCreationModal` on form submission.

ladn

May 16 2023, 10:09 PM
atul updated the diff for D7847: [web] Call `create_thread` from `CommunityCreationModal` on form submission.

address feedback

May 16 2023, 9:49 PM
atul added inline comments to D7847: [web] Call `create_thread` from `CommunityCreationModal` on form submission.
May 16 2023, 9:10 PM
atul updated the test plan for D7847: [web] Call `create_thread` from `CommunityCreationModal` on form submission.
May 16 2023, 8:05 PM
atul published D7847: [web] Call `create_thread` from `CommunityCreationModal` on form submission for review.
May 16 2023, 8:02 PM
atul resigned from D7815: Send encrypted notifications to iOS devices.
May 16 2023, 4:44 PM
atul added inline comments to D7814: Implement method in NSE to decrypt notification.
May 16 2023, 4:40 PM
atul resigned from D7814: Implement method in NSE to decrypt notification.
May 16 2023, 4:39 PM
atul resigned from D7813: Implement function to encrypt relevant parts of iOS notification.
May 16 2023, 4:39 PM
atul resigned from D7631: Implement utilities and database query wrapper to create new olm session on eht keyserver side.

(feel free to add me back if there's something specific I can be helpful w/, don't have a ton of context here)

May 16 2023, 4:39 PM
atul accepted D7765: [native] Add thumbHash prop to image components.

Sweet, thanks for addressing feedback!

May 16 2023, 4:36 PM
atul accepted D7841: [native] Factor out loading spinner from SIWEPanel.
May 16 2023, 4:34 PM
atul accepted D7840: [native] Make SIWEPanel more generic.
May 16 2023, 4:26 PM
atul accepted D7839: [landing] introduce new header elements to header component.

I don't want to request changes and block this diff, but very extremely strongly feel that we should use the existing and well understood h1 -> h6 system of categorizing text styles instead of rolling our own that "acts in parallel."

May 16 2023, 3:45 PM
atul attached a referenced file: F541269: 661fe7.png.
May 16 2023, 3:35 PM
atul accepted D7842: [lib] fix pinned content for non-media messages.
May 16 2023, 3:35 PM
atul accepted D7835: [landing] update header strucutre to use flexbox over grid.

Flexbox is a bit more simple to use/understand

May 16 2023, 3:01 PM
atul accepted D7821: [native] Vertically center Ethereum logo in ConnectEthereum.
May 16 2023, 1:07 AM

May 15 2023

atul accepted D7804: Add thumbhash field to multimedia messages.
May 15 2023, 8:15 PM
atul accepted D7781: [landing] animate mobile nav component.
May 15 2023, 7:58 PM
atul attached a referenced file: F539578: 8ba613.png.
May 15 2023, 7:55 PM
atul accepted D7763: [landing] introduce mobile nav compoment.

<MobileNav> component looks clean!

May 15 2023, 7:55 PM
atul accepted D7802: [native] Add thumbhash step to media mission.
May 15 2023, 7:34 PM
atul accepted D7780: [native] Implement thumbhash generation on Android.

Defer to @ashoat (setting as blocking) on license/attribution/dependency management.

May 15 2023, 7:19 PM
atul added a reviewer for D7779: [native] Implement thumbhash generation on iOS: ashoat.
May 15 2023, 6:57 PM
atul attached a referenced file: F539566: 48780b.png.
May 15 2023, 6:57 PM
atul attached a referenced file: F539568: 0a3ad7.png.
May 15 2023, 6:57 PM
atul accepted D7779: [native] Implement thumbhash generation on iOS.

Looks good to me!

May 15 2023, 6:57 PM
atul accepted D7820: [native] Introduce designSystemColors to colors.js.

Sweet, I think this will make colors.js much easier to work w/ in the future.

May 15 2023, 6:13 PM
atul requested changes to D7765: [native] Add thumbHash prop to image components.

Looks good at a high level. Thanks for including examples in the Test Plan!

May 15 2023, 6:11 PM
atul accepted D7761: [native] Add utils to encrypt/decrypt base64 string.

I'm guessing these utilities are going to be used widely, so it'd be good to make sure they're as robust as possible. Left some notes inline.

May 15 2023, 5:55 PM
atul closed D7764: [web] Basic `CommunityCreationModal` layout/styling.
May 15 2023, 4:06 PM
atul committed rCOMM9ca18e1b6dea: [web] Basic `CommunityCreationModal` layout/styling.
May 15 2023, 4:06 PM
atul attached a referenced file: F539399: ab0309.png.
May 15 2023, 4:03 PM
atul added inline comments to D7758: [native] Add C++ function to decode base64.
May 15 2023, 4:03 PM
atul updated the diff for D7764: [web] Basic `CommunityCreationModal` layout/styling.

use &apos;

May 15 2023, 3:58 PM
atul updated the diff for D7764: [web] Basic `CommunityCreationModal` layout/styling.

rebase before addressing feedback

May 15 2023, 3:57 PM
atul accepted D7812: Update to @commapp/olm@0.0.10.
May 15 2023, 3:48 PM
atul closed D7784: [keyserver] Add `COMMUNITY_[ANNOUNCEMENT_]ROOT` to `newThreadRequestInputValidator`.
May 15 2023, 2:54 PM
atul committed rCOMM434c16a90efc: [keyserver] Add `COMMUNITY_[ANNOUNCEMENT_]ROOT` to….
May 15 2023, 2:54 PM
atul updated the diff for D7784: [keyserver] Add `COMMUNITY_[ANNOUNCEMENT_]ROOT` to `newThreadRequestInputValidator`.

rebase and land

May 15 2023, 2:53 PM
atul attached a referenced file: F539123: de6474.png.
May 15 2023, 2:29 PM
atul added inline comments to D7779: [native] Implement thumbhash generation on iOS.
May 15 2023, 2:29 PM
atul added inline comments to D7779: [native] Implement thumbhash generation on iOS.
May 15 2023, 2:28 PM

May 11 2023

atul awarded D7787: [web-db] stop supporting Safari a Heartbreak token.
May 11 2023, 9:03 AM

May 10 2023

atul published D7784: [keyserver] Add `COMMUNITY_[ANNOUNCEMENT_]ROOT` to `newThreadRequestInputValidator` for review.
May 10 2023, 5:04 PM
atul added a comment to D7766: [landing] memoize header and footer.

I may have misread the following from (https://blog.isquaredsoftware.com/2020/05/blogged-answers-a-mostly-complete-guide-to-react-rendering-behavior/#component-render-optimization-techniques) and misled @ginsu here:

May 10 2023, 4:26 PM
atul attached a referenced file: F533157: Screen Shot 2023-05-10 at 3.48.49 PM.png.
May 10 2023, 1:49 PM
atul added a comment to D7764: [web] Basic `CommunityCreationModal` layout/styling.

Updated to display "@ ashoat" as default keyserver. Also made the modal "large" so the copy would fit a bit better:

May 10 2023, 1:48 PM
atul updated the diff for D7764: [web] Basic `CommunityCreationModal` layout/styling.

placeholder keyserver name

May 10 2023, 1:47 PM
atul added inline comments to D7756: [landing] introduce colors from design system.
May 10 2023, 12:24 PM
atul accepted D7756: [landing] introduce colors from design system.
May 10 2023, 12:23 PM
atul accepted D7755: [landing] introduce new typography design system.

I also locally tested every typography and made sure that they matched what was in the designs

May 10 2023, 12:21 PM
atul accepted D7759: [landing] update landing background color.
May 10 2023, 12:18 PM
atul accepted D7757: [landing] remove star background.
May 10 2023, 12:17 PM
atul resigned from D7767: [Nix] Add more support for localstack.
May 10 2023, 12:17 PM
atul accepted D7776: [native] Add copy for ConnectEthereum screen.

(Personally think it might look better if the Ethereum logo was above the text)

May 10 2023, 12:16 PM
atul planned changes to D7764: [web] Basic `CommunityCreationModal` layout/styling.
May 10 2023, 10:58 AM
atul updated the diff for D7764: [web] Basic `CommunityCreationModal` layout/styling.

partially address feedback (copy)

May 10 2023, 10:55 AM
atul added inline comments to D7764: [web] Basic `CommunityCreationModal` layout/styling.
May 10 2023, 10:47 AM

May 9 2023

atul added a comment to D7764: [web] Basic `CommunityCreationModal` layout/styling.
In D7764#230485, @ginsu wrote:

could you link the figma?

May 9 2023, 3:37 PM
atul added inline comments to D7764: [web] Basic `CommunityCreationModal` layout/styling.
May 9 2023, 2:58 PM
atul requested review of D7764: [web] Basic `CommunityCreationModal` layout/styling.
May 9 2023, 2:55 PM
atul accepted D7752: [native] show setting threadStore error in Alert message.
May 9 2023, 10:38 AM
atul accepted D7689: [web] Add function to upload media to Blob service.

Looks good, would be good to get response on snake_case error messages before landing.

May 9 2023, 10:33 AM
atul attached a referenced file: F527706: Screen Shot 2023-05-08 at 6.33.55 PM.png.
May 9 2023, 10:29 AM
atul accepted D7649: [native] Add function to upload media to blob service.

Looks good, left a couple of minor notes. Would be good to get response on snake_case error messages before landing.

May 9 2023, 10:29 AM
atul accepted D7748: [native] Bump expo and expo-image.

Changes look good, adding @ashoat as blocking (as formality) since it's a dependency diff.

May 9 2023, 10:22 AM

May 8 2023

atul accepted D7742: [native] Show a pin icon next to pinned messages.

Disregard... it's a class component. My bad.

May 8 2023, 4:29 PM
atul requested changes to D7742: [native] Show a pin icon next to pinned messages.
May 8 2023, 4:24 PM
atul added a comment to D7737: [lib/native] add more icons to comm icon pack.

It'd also be good to test on native to make sure the generated TTF glyphs look as expected.

May 8 2023, 4:16 PM
atul accepted D7737: [lib/native] add more icons to comm icon pack.

Does the sizing look right? Can't really tell from the images from the Test Plan, but as long as things looked right during your testing.

May 8 2023, 4:15 PM
atul accepted D7732: [native] Add Ethereum logo to ConnectEthereum screen.
May 8 2023, 3:40 PM
atul accepted D7729: [native] Introduce ConnectEthereum screen.
May 8 2023, 3:08 PM
atul accepted D7725: [native] Rename RegistrationButton state prop to variant.
May 8 2023, 3:07 PM
atul accepted D7724: [native] Get rid of React.cloneElement stuff in RegistrationTile.
May 8 2023, 2:27 PM
atul accepted D7723: [native] Introduce CoolOrNerdModeSelection screen.
May 8 2023, 2:26 PM
atul closed D7722: [native] Memoize `roundCorners` in `community-pill`.
May 8 2023, 2:21 PM
atul committed rCOMM6cb4c89ac6a2: [native] Memoize `roundCorners` in `community-pill`.
May 8 2023, 2:21 PM
atul accepted D7614: [native] Display the number of pinned messages in a banner across chat.
May 8 2023, 2:19 PM
atul accepted D7673: [native] Display the pinned messages for the thread in the new screen.
May 8 2023, 2:17 PM
atul accepted D7607: [native] Create the toggle pin modal.
May 8 2023, 2:15 PM
atul updated the diff for D7722: [native] Memoize `roundCorners` in `community-pill`.

address feedback

May 8 2023, 12:52 PM
atul updated the diff for D7722: [native] Memoize `roundCorners` in `community-pill`.

rebase (fixing env)

May 8 2023, 12:50 PM
atul added inline comments to D7649: [native] Add function to upload media to blob service.
May 8 2023, 11:40 AM
atul updated the diff for D7722: [native] Memoize `roundCorners` in `community-pill`.

rebase before addressing feedback

May 8 2023, 10:19 AM
atul added a comment to D7722: [native] Memoize `roundCorners` in `community-pill`.

Can we just pull this outside of the function body?

May 8 2023, 10:12 AM
atul closed D7721: [web] Introduce barebones `CommunityCreationModal`.
May 8 2023, 10:09 AM
atul committed rCOMM64d8883bd7ac: [web] Introduce barebones `CommunityCreationModal`.
May 8 2023, 10:09 AM
atul updated the diff for D7721: [web] Introduce barebones `CommunityCreationModal`.

actually land

May 8 2023, 10:04 AM
atul updated the diff for D7721: [web] Introduce barebones `CommunityCreationModal`.

rebase

May 8 2023, 9:58 AM
atul updated the diff for D7721: [web] Introduce barebones `CommunityCreationModal`.

rebase before landing

May 8 2023, 9:35 AM

May 4 2023

atul requested review of D7722: [native] Memoize `roundCorners` in `community-pill`.
May 4 2023, 7:48 PM